Blue Energy plans to develop a 1.5 gigawatt small modular reactor (SMR) project in partnership with Crusoe, a data center developer. The project will be located at the Port of Victoria, Texas, with a site secured under an October agreement.
Blue Energy aims to mitigate cost overruns and expedite construction by fabricating SMR components at existing oil and gas facilities. The partnership will employ existing transmission and gas infrastructure at the Victoria site, supplying gas to the Crusoe AI data center by 2028 before transitioning to nuclear power by 2031. The reactor technology will be partially buried underground within a cooling pool.
